PAM 00090
The power reserve lets the wearer check the remaining power at any time by
the indicator on the dial. This function was developed by Officine
Panerai's master watchmakers who created a transmission system connecting
the barrel's winding spring and the movement's gear train with the power
reserve indicator, which moves as the winding spring transmits the
accumulated energy to the movement wheels. The case of the Luminor Power
Reserve - 44 mm, made of polished steel, is water-resistant to 30 BAR (~300
metres) and has the characteristic drawbridge: the mechanism was designed
by Officine Panerai to protect the crown but most of all to make it
waterproof, as it is one of the most delicate parts of a watch when
immersed in water. The dial of the Luminor Power Reserve - 44 mm, with a
black background, bears the unmistakable Officine Panerai style: large
markers, luminescent Arabic numbers and hands, all of which guarantee
exceptional visibility under all conditions of use. In addition to the
small seconds dial at 9 o'clock and which is constantly moving, the watch
also has an arched sector between 4 and 5 o'clock: this is the power
reserve indicator, marking off the number of remaining hours of power.
Above that is the date indicator, with a magnifying glass inserted in the
3.5-mm thick, non-reflective sapphire crystal.
Case Size: 44mm
Buckle: Deployant
Materials: Steel
Dial: Black
Movement: Automatic OP IX calibre
Water Resistance: 30 bar
Complications: Hours, minutes, small seconds, date, power reserve indicator
Case Back: Plain
Strap : Black alligator
Reference #: Pam00090
